1. Storage Chips: The “New Oil” of the Data Era

Core Logic: The explosion of AI computing power has driven demand for storage, with HBM and 3D NAND technology becoming key breakthroughs.

1. GigaDevice:

Ranked third globally in NOR Flash market share, automotive-grade MCU certified by ASIL-D, with a 40% share in the industrial control sector;

Technical Breakthrough: Self-developed 19nm DDR5 mass production yield reaches 95%, HBM2 samples sent to Huawei Ascend;

2. Yangtze Memory Technologies:

Leading in 3D NAND flash memory, Xtacking® architecture achieves 232-layer stacking, with costs 20% lower than Samsung;

Estimated valuation exceeds 160 billion in 2025, securing major contracts in Southeast Asia’s data centers;

3. Beijing Junzheng:

Acquired ISSI to enter automotive storage, with a DRAM market share of over 30%, core supplier for Tesla’s FSD chip;

Tesla FSD chip collaboration + EU Tier 1 certification, leading player in automotive storage;

Technical Barriers: 3D stacking technology (Yangtze Memory), automotive certification (Junzheng), HBM technology (Changxin Memory);

2. MCU Chips: The “Brain” of Smart Terminals

Core Logic: The Internet of Things has created a market worth billions, with RISC-V architecture breaking ARM’s monopoly.

4. Rockchip:

AIoT flagship chip RK3588 (8nm process) in mass production, NPU computing power of 6 TOPS suitable for smart cockpits;

Expected mid-2025 report increase of 185%-195%, with automotive electronics revenue exceeding 15%;

5. Chipone:

Ranked first in the small appliance MCU market, core supplier for Midea/Gree, entering lithium battery management chips for new energy vehicles, with Q1 2025 sales of 885 million units, and industrial control share exceeding 30%;

6. Fengfan Technology:

Invisible champion in motor drive control chips, automotive-grade MCU yield exceeds 99%, with a 20% market share in photovoltaic inverters;

Q1 2025 net profit margin of 29.45%, gross margin of 52.5% leading the industry;

Technical Barriers: RISC-V architecture (Fengfan), automotive certification (GigaDevice), AI computing power integration (Rockchip);

3. Automotive Chips: The “Heart” of Intelligent Driving

Core Logic: Level 4 autonomous driving drives chip upgrades, with silicon carbide power devices becoming a new battlefield;

7. Weir Shares:

Ranked second globally in automotive CIS (25% market share), mass production of 8-megapixel ADAS cameras;

Q1 2025 revenue of 13.4 billion, with intelligent driving business growth exceeding 200%;

8. BYD:

Self-developed automotive-grade MCU covering power systems, IDM model yield exceeds 99%, reducing costs by 30%;

Vertical integration advantage: Top 3 in new energy vehicle sales with full support;

9. Unisoc:

THD89 series certified by ASIL-D, automotive-grade MCU covering chassis/intelligent driving systems;

Pioneer in domestic substitution: The localization rate of military and automotive projects increases by 104% annually;

Technical Barriers: ASIL-D functional safety certification (Unisoc), silicon carbide process (Sida Semiconductor), integrated cockpit solutions (Desay SV);

4. Driving Logic and Risk Warning

》》》》Three Golden Tracks:

Accelerated domestic substitution: The localization rate of automotive-grade MCUs increases from 5% to 30% (2025E), with the self-sufficiency rate of storage chips exceeding 25%;

Technical upgrade dividends: RISC-V architecture penetration exceeds 35%, AI edge computing power (≥2 TOPS) becomes the new standard;

Confirmed demand explosion: More than 100 MCUs used per vehicle, with the smart cockpit chip market expected to reach 150 billion by 2025..

》》》》Risk Warning:

Dependence on high-end process equipment (photolithography/etching equipment localization rate < 20%), price wars from international giants (Samsung/Micron price cuts squeezing domestic manufacturers), long automotive certification cycles (2-3 years) leading to performance fluctuations..
